printed

Aussprache: [/ˈpɹɪn.tɪd/]

Wort

Kontext: „physical form“

(adjective) used to describe something that has words or images imprinted on paper or another material. When you see a book or a poster with words or pictures on it, that item is printed.

Kontext: „production“

(verb) the act of making multiple copies of words or images on paper or another material using a machine. When a company produces magazines or newspapers, they are printed using machines.
